Daily Thai Confidence — Using ความทรงจำ (khwāam-sōng-jām)

Noun: ความทรงจำ (khwāam-sōng-jām)
Meaning: memory / memories / recollection

In this Thai lesson, we learn how to use the noun ความทรงจำ (khwāam-sōng-jām), which means ‘memory,’ ‘memories,’ or ‘recollection.’ It refers to things that a person remembers from the past, including experiences, events, people, places, and feelings.

It is made up of two words:

  • ความ (khwāam) = a prefix used to turn verbs and adjectives into abstract nouns
  • ทรงจำ (sōng-jām) = to remember

Together, ความทรงจำ (khwāam-sōng-jām) means “memory’ or ‘recollection.’

For examples (ตัวอย่างเช่น — dtūa-awyàang chên)

ฉันยังมีความทรงจำดีๆเกี่ยวกับเขา

chǎn yāng mēe khwāam-sōng-jām gìew-gàb khǎo
Literal: I still  have memory good-good about him.
I still have good memories of him.

The preposition เกี่ยวกับ (gìew-gàb) means ‘about,’ ‘regarding,’ or ‘concerning.’ It is used to show the topic or subject that something relates to. It connects information, speech, writing, or actions to a topic.

เธอชอบนึกถึงความทรงจำในวัยเด็ก

thēr châwb néuk-thěung khwāam-sōng-jām nāi wāi-dèk
Literal: She like think-arrive memory in age-child.
She likes to reminisce about her childhood memories.

The verb นึกถึง (néuk-thěung) means ‘to think of,’ ‘to recall,’ or ‘to be reminded of.’ It is used when something makes you remember a person, place, event, feeling, or idea from the past.

ฉันถ่ายรูปไว้เพื่อเก็บเป็นความทรงจำ

chǎn thàai-rûub wái phêua gèb bpēn khwāam-sōng-jām
Literal: I take-picture keep in order to collect to be memory.
I took the photos to keep as memories.

The verb ถ่ายรูป (thàai-rûub) means ‘to take a photo’ or ‘to take pictures.’ It is used in everyday life whenever someone uses a camera or a phone to capture an image.

เธอเป็นส่วนหนึ่งของความทรงจำที่มีค่าของฉัน

thēr bpēn sùan hnèung khǎwng khwāam-sōng-jām thêe mēe khâa khǎwng-chǎn
Literal: She to be part one belonging to memory that have value belonging to-me.
She is a part of my precious memories.

The verb phrase เป็นส่วนหนึ่ง (bpēn sùan hnèung) means ‘to be part of,’ ‘to be a part of,’ or ‘to be one component of something larger.’ It is commonly used to show that someone or something belongs within a bigger group, system, experience, or whole.

Homework (การบ้าน — gāan-bâan)

Practise putting your newly learned Thai word into a sentence by translating the following sentences below.

  1. These photos make me think of old memories.
  2. That trip was full of good memories.
  3. I want to keep this moment as a memory.
  4. This house is full of memories.
  5. That day is an important memory.
